Incognizack (25.00 Elementary)
Strategic Design, Optimisation and Technology Solutions for perfomance driven and customer based organisations.
South Africa Joined March 2018
Strategic Design, Optimisation and Technology Solutions for perfomance driven and customer based organisations.
South Africa Joined March 2018